How Can Your Utah Wedding Cake Reflect the Season?

When planning your Utah wedding cake, considering the season of your celebration is a wonderful starting point for design inspiration. Think about the natural elements, colors, and feelings associated with that time of year. For spring, consider soft pastels, delicate floral motifs, and a sense of freshness. Summer might inspire brighter colors, lush greenery, or even fruit-inspired accents. Autumn often lends itself to richer, warmer tones, natural textures, and perhaps harvest-themed details. Winter can evoke shimmering whites, metallic accents, or deep, jewel-toned colors.

A two-tier cake like the one pictured here is a perfect canvas for seasonal expression. Its elegant simplicity allows for a single, impactful design element, such as this blush pink bow, to truly shine. For larger celebrations, three-tier designs start at $650, offering more surface area for intricate details or multiple design elements, while four and five-tier designs, starting at $875, provide a grand statement for larger guest lists and more elaborate concepts. Discussing your season and color preferences during your initial consultation helps us tailor a design that is uniquely yours.

The Flavors

Flavour is chosen at your tasting, where you select three cakes and three fillings from the full Sweet E’s menu. Signature options include vanilla bean, almond, lemon and salted caramel, each paired with buttercreams, curds and ganaches that suit the design. Vegan, dairy free and gluten friendly versions are available for most cakes, so tell us about any dietary needs when you inquire and we will build them into your quote.

Questions Couples Ask

How far in advance should I order my Utah wedding cake?

We recommend securing your wedding cake order six to nine months in advance, especially for peak wedding seasons. This allows ample time for design consultations, tasting appointments, and for us to give your bespoke cake the detailed attention it deserves. For last-minute inquiries, please contact us directly for availability.

How much does a custom wedding cake typically cost?

Our two-tier custom wedding cakes start at $450, three-tier designs begin at $650, and four and five-tier cakes start at $875. These prices reflect the luxury ingredients, meticulous design work, and personalized service that define the Sweet E’s Bakery experience. Final pricing is determined by the complexity of your chosen design.

Do you offer tastings for wedding cakes?

Yes, we offer private tasting experiences for $50, which include three distinct cake flavors and three delicious fillings. This fee is complimentary with any wedding cake order totaling over $300, allowing you to confidently select the perfect flavors for your special day. Please ask about dietary accommodations during your inquiry.
